This document contains a formal report regarding an Unidentified Flying Object (UFO) sighting that occurred on 19 November 1960 at Tyndall Air Force Base, Florida. The report was filed by a Master Sergeant from the Training Section and addressed to the Aerospace Technical Intelligence Center (ATIC) at Wright-Patterson AFB, Ohio. The witness, who was at his residence in Capehart, Tyndall AFB, observed an elliptical object at approximately 1810 hours. He described the object as being the size of a baseball, larger than the evening star, and very bright. The object initially traveled from south to north with a steady course, though it exhibited a slight weaving motion in the rear. The witness noted that the object appeared to be at a great altitude, as it seemed to be reflecting sunlight. The sighting lasted between eight and ten minutes. The witness, who had observed other satellites and UFOs previously, noted that this particular object was less stable than others he had seen. He reported the incident to the Tyndall Base Weather Station. Following the report, an investigation was conducted, and a check with Spacetrack confirmed that the object observed was the satellite Echo I. The document includes a record card, a copy of a newspaper clipping regarding the visibility of the Echo I satellite, and a hand-drawn diagram illustrating the path of the object relative to the witness's location. The report concludes that the sighting was definitively identified as the satellite.
